Avoid Outdoor Air Pollution Exposure

The hazards associated with outdoor air pollution are a growing concern, particularly for individuals residing in urban areas. Pollutants such as particulate matter, ozone, and nitrogen dioxide have been linked to a range of adverse health effects, including exacerbation of asthma, bronchitis, and other respiratory diseases. Awareness and understanding of the risks posed by these pollutants are crucial for minimizing their impact on lung health. By staying informed about local air quality indexes and planning outdoor activities accordingly, individuals can significantly reduce their exposure to harmful air pollutants.

Adopting protective measures during periods of high pollution is essential for maintaining lung health. Strategies such as wearing masks designed to filter out particulate matter, utilizing air purifiers at home, and selecting indoor exercise options can greatly diminish the inhalation of pollutants. Additionally, planting greenery around living spaces can act as a natural air filter, contributing to cleaner air both indoors and outdoors. These proactive steps can help safeguard respiratory health against the detrimental effects of air pollution.

Exercise Regularly

Engaging in regular physical activity is paramount for sustaining healthy lungs. Exercise enhances cardiovascular health and ensures the efficient functioning of respiratory muscles, facilitating a greater exchange of oxygen and carbon dioxide. Aerobic exercises, in particular, are known to improve endurance and lung capacity, making it easier for the body to utilize oxygen and expel waste gases. For individuals with chronic lung conditions, tailored exercise programs can offer significant improvements in quality of life and symptom management.

Creating a consistent exercise regimen is critical for reaping the full benefits of physical activity on lung health. Activities such as brisk walking, cycling, swimming, and jogging are highly effective in boosting respiratory strength and efficiency. Starting with moderate intensity and gradually increasing the duration and difficulty of workouts can help avoid injury and ensure steady progress. Moreover, engaging in outdoor activities when air quality is good combines the advantages of physical exercise with exposure to fresh air, further enhancing lung function.

Maintain Healthy Weight

The relationship between body weight and lung health is often overlooked. Excessive weight can lead to increased pressure on the lungs and diaphragm, making breathing more laborious and potentially exacerbating respiratory conditions. Managing body weight through a balanced diet and regular exercise is essential for minimizing these risks and ensuring optimal lung function. Moreover, obesity has been linked to a higher incidence of asthma and obstructive sleep apnea, underscoring the importance of weight management in respiratory health.

Adopting lifestyle changes that promote a healthy weight can significantly improve lung capacity and efficiency. A diet rich in fruits, vegetables, and lean proteins, combined with regular physical activity, can help achieve and maintain a weight that supports lung health. Additionally, these changes can lead to reduced inflammation in the body, further benefiting respiratory function. For those struggling with weight management, seeking guidance from healthcare professionals can provide personalized strategies and support.
